Chicago (ORD) to Corlu (TEQ)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D) in Chicago, United States to Tekirdag Corlu Airport (TEQ) in Corlu, Turkey is 8,750 kilometers (5,437 miles / 4,725 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 11h, flying northeast at a heading of 44°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ting United States with Turkey. It is an intercontinental flight between North America and Asia.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 03:00 in Chicago, it's 12:00 in Corlu. With a 9-hour time difference, travelers should plan for significant jet lag. It typically takes one day per hour of time difference to fully adjust.

The return flight from Corlu (TEQ) to Chicago (ORD) follows a heading of 317° (northw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
